发明名称 Improvements in or relating to the control of centrifugal fans, pumps and the like
摘要 464,844. Centrifugal fans. DAVIDSON & CO., Ltd., and WHITMORE, J. Oct. 30, 1935, No. 29990. [Class 110 (i)] A centrifugal fan is regulated, at all loads under the maximum, by the division of the entering air into two controllable portions ; one passes through the main inlet and the other through a secondary inlet which gives the air a rotary flow in the direction of rotation of the fan impeller. The fan shown has an impeller 2 working in the casing 1 provided with a tangential outlet 4 and main inlet 5. An annular chamber 8 is formed by a casing 7 round the main inlet 5, from which it is separated by a system of stationary vanes 6. This vaned space forms the secondary inlet and gives the entering air a whirling motion. The effective area of the main inlet 5 is varied by two dampers 9 which can be moved inwards or outwards together by means of a right and left-handed screw 11 rotated by a handle 13. Each damper may consist of two relatively movable plates of substantially crescent shape, one plate being arranged to move faster than the other by means of screw threads of different pitches. The chamber 8 may be situated partly inside the fan casing 1 so that the vanes 6 are within that casing, or the vanes may project at an angle into the casing 1 as shown in Fig. 5. The outer ends of the dampers are made to cover the openings to the chamber 8 between the shields 20, when the dampers are in their outermost position to give full access to the main entry 5 under full load conditions. The dampers may be actuated by levers operated by a screwthreaded rod, or by two endless belts 23, 23a, Fig. 7, round pulleys 19, 22 of different diameters. Semi-cylindrical shields 25, Fig. 10, may be attached to extensions on the dampers to diminish the quantity of air passing between the vanes when the main inlet 5 is closed. These shields 25, may have extensions 28 to prevent air from passing through the space behind'the shields 20 to the secondary inlet. When the fan is under full load the dampers 9 are open to the fullest extent thereby closing the secondary inlet so that all air enters by the main inlet 5. When the fan is under partial load the dampers are moved inwards, so that air enters the secondary inlet between the vanes and joins the main stream and imparts a rotary motion to it. A damper 14 in the fan outlet 4 provides for further volume regulation.
